Drug Product Performance: In Vitro–In Vivo Correlation

11
In pharmaceutical development, it's crucial to establish a predictive in vitro–in vivo correlation (IVIVC) for two or more formulations to gain a comprehensive understanding of release properties. IVIVC reduces the need for costly in vivo studies and facilitates the establishment of meaningful dissolution specifications with significant cost savings and decreased regulatory burden. Furthermore, a meaningful IVIVC should predict Cmax and AUC within 20%, aligning with FDA guidance while...

Cancer Vaccines

547
Cancer treatment vaccines are a rapidly evolving field that offers a promising approach to immunotherapy. Unlike traditional vaccines that prevent diseases, cancer treatment vaccines are designed to treat existing cancers by stimulating the immune system to recognize and attack cancer cells.
Cancer vaccines come in two categories: preventive (prophylactic) and treatment (active). Preventive vaccines, such as the Human Papillomavirus (HPV) vaccine, protect against viruses that cause certain...

Principles of Disease Surveillance

219
Disease surveillance is the systematic collection, analysis, and interpretation of health data essential to the planning, implementation, and evaluation of public health practice. This process integrates data dissemination to entities responsible for preventing and controlling disease, injury, and disability. Surveillance systems provide crucial information for action, helping public health authorities make informed decisions to manage and prevent outbreaks, ensure public safety, optimize...

Causality in Epidemiology

1.0K
Causality or causation is a fundamental concept in epidemiology, vital for understanding the relationships between various factors and health outcomes. Despite its importance, there's no single, universally accepted definition of causality within the discipline. Drawing from a systematic review, causality in epidemiology encompasses several definitions, including production, necessary and sufficient, sufficient-component, counterfactual, and probabilistic models. Each has its strengths and...

Immune Response Against Viral Pathogens

1.0K
The immune system's response to viral infections is a complex and coordinated process involving natural killer (NK) cells, T cell-mediated responses, and antibody-mediated responses.
NK Cells
NK cells are a crucial part of our innate immune system, acting as the first line of defense against viral infections. These cells can recognize and kill infected cells without prior exposure to the virus, effectively slowing down the spread of infection. Additionally, NK cells produce proinflammatory...

使用相关物来加速疫苗学

Peter J M Openshaw1

  • 1National Heart and Lung Institute, Imperial College London, London, UK.

Science (New York, N.Y.)
|January 6, 2022
PubMed
概括

相对应物和替代物对于测量结果是有用的,但具有局限性. 需要进一步研究以了解它们在科学研究中的全部潜力和缺点.

科学领域:

  • 生物医学研究
  • 临床试验
  • 结果测量

背景情况:

  • 在研究中经常使用相关物和替代物.
  • 它们在有效测量结果方面提供了潜在的优势.
  • 然而,它们的局限性可能会影响研究结果的有效性.

研究的目的:

  • 讨论相关和替代品的有用性.
  • 突出与使用相关的固有局限性.
  • 强调在研究设计中需要仔细考虑.

主要方法:

  • 使用相关物和替代物研究的文献综述.
  • 分析一些例子,说明局限性.
  • 讨论统计和临床影响.

主要成果:

  • 可以提供有价值的见解.
  • 替代品和真实结果之间存在显著的差异.
  • 误解可能导致错误的结论和无效的干预.

结论:

  • 虽然它们很有价值,但必须谨慎解释它们的相关性和替代性.
